A happy circumstance: Bob Ross paintings sell for more than $600K to help public TV stations

Three paintings from famously chill public television legend Bob Ross sold Tuesday for more than $600,000 at auction. The paintings were the first of 30 Ross works being sold to benefit public TV stations hurt by cuts in federal funding.

All ByHeart infant formula products recalled over botulism concern

The recall, which was first reported over the weekend, was expanded to include all ByHeart products on November 10 due to an ongoing nationwide outbreak of infant botulism.
